    Sushi Rock Closing Short North Location

    The Columbus location of Sushi Rock will be closing for good following a final night of service on Saturday, September 28th. The Cleveland-based chain expanded to Columbus four years ago, and according to an official Facebook post, they were unable to renew their lease and have decided to “re-establish their presence in the Cleveland market”. A new location is planned on the west side of Cleveland.

    Saturday’s final night of business begins at 7pm and is open to the public.
